02uni-assist or direct

Germany has no single national portal. There are two channels, and which one you use is decided by the university, not by you.

uni-assist: a centralised portal that pre-checks and forwards applications to many universities, and evaluates foreign credentials

Direct: some institutions run their own portals and do not use uni-assist

Check each university's page before assuming. uni-assist charges per application — a higher fee for the first university and a lower one for each additional in the same cycle — so batching your applications within one cycle is cheaper than spreading them.


03the bachelor's bridge

This is the structural fact that reshapes Germany for school-leavers, and it is better understood before you apply than after.

if you are applying after +2

Nepal's 10+2 is generally not treated as equivalent to the German university-entrance qualification, so direct bachelor's entry usually needs a Studienkolleg foundation year or one completed year of a Nepali bachelor's first.

So there are two routes into a German bachelor's: a Studienkolleg foundation year ending in the Feststellungsprüfung, or one completed year of a Nepali bachelor's before you apply. Neither is a penalty — both are normal — but both need to be in your plan and your budget from the start.

Master's applicants with a completed Nepali bachelor's mostly avoid this entirely, which is why Germany suits postgraduate applicants considerably better than school-leavers.

Note the embassy's narrower rule at visa stage: German certificates are accepted from Goethe Kathmandu, VHS Bhaktapur or Pokhara, or Telc only. A certificate from elsewhere may satisfy your university and still not satisfy the embassy — check both before you pay for a course.

Everything in Nepali needs a certified translation into German or English. Arrange these early — they sit on the critical path for both the university and the embassy.

Nepal step — get the MoEST NOC before remitting any tuition or blocked-account deposit

A blocked-account deposit is a remittance like any other, so it needs the NOC first. Sequencing this wrongly is one of the more common ways Nepali applicants lose weeks.
